Netflix Unveils Trailer for 'The Recruit' Season 2, Premiering January 30
The new season follows CIA lawyer Owen Hendricks in a high-stakes mission in South Korea as internal threats loom large.
- Season 2 of Netflix's spy thriller 'The Recruit' premieres on January 30, 2025, with six episodes, down from eight in the first season.
- The story centers on CIA lawyer-turned-operative Owen Hendricks, played by Noah Centineo, navigating a dangerous mission in South Korea while uncovering potential threats within the Agency itself.
- Season 2 introduces Teo Yoo as Jang Kyun Kim, who partners with Owen for action-packed sequences, including a fight scene in a K-Pop club.
- The trailer features a Korean rendition of Green Day's 'American Idiot,' setting the tone for the espionage drama's international backdrop.
- The series is created by Alexi Hawley, with Noah Centineo and other key figures returning as executive producers alongside a mix of new and familiar cast members.
